Pokesav HGSS US doesn't seem to have the Johto locations in it when editing a pokemon, which makes it impossible to create a pokemon that originated from a HGSS game..
I've tried messing with the hidden hex values by following a guide, but it didn't do what I was aiming for; in fact, it didn't do anything. (I probably did that wrong though.)
So, is editing the hex values the way to accomplish a HGSS-originated pokemon? Say, a Magikarp from Lake Rage. If it is, I'll just keep "trial-and-erroring" till I get it correct.
Or am I just going to have to wait for a fix?
Secret ID AR code for HS acting odd.
in RAM - NDS Help
Posted
I used that same code for HG. I got my SID: 62174.
Later on, after discovering that save files can't be uploaded to a computer for HGSS yet, I uploaded a Platinum file (that had a Sandshrew caught in Union Cave on HG on it). Instead of it having a SID of 62174, it's 31916.
I then decided to test it out. I created a Typhlosion with a SID of 62174. I transferred it back to HG. I battled something, and it gained a "boosted" amount of EXP, meaning it still hadn't originated from my game. I then altered the SID to 31916 and did the same thing. No boosted EXP.
So, I guess the code is just... wrong.
